Learning Outcomes
1.
Explains the art and structures of microprocessing and
microcomputer system.
2.
Apply binary, decimal, and hexadecimal number systems.
3.
Explains type of programming language, examples of its use,
and flowchart.
4.
Describes common networking system and topology.
5.
Explains technology related to the Internet, including World
Wide Web and other protocols.
6.
Explains the use of computer in healthcare industry,
especially in prosthetic and orthotic.
Synopsis
Microprocessing system, microcomputer, network system,
Internet, computers in healthcare industry with major emphasis
on prosthetic and orthotic. Application of number system and
programming language.
